Dela via


Så här använder du kommandot BlobFuse2 för att montera alla blobcontainrar i ett lagringskonto som ett Linux-filsystem

blobfuse2 mount all Använd kommandot för att montera alla blobcontainrar i ett lagringskonto som ett Linux-filsystem. Varje container monteras på en unik underkatalog under den angivna sökvägen. Underkatalognamnen motsvarar containernamnen.

Syntax

blobfuse2 mount all [path] --[flag-name]=[flag-value]

Argument

[path]

Ange en filsökväg till katalogen där alla bloblagringscontainrar i lagringskontot ska monteras. Exempel:

blobfuse2 mount all ./mount_path ...

Flaggor (alternativ)

Flaggor som gäller för blobfuse2 mount all ärvs från de överordnade kommandona och blobfuse2blobfuse2 mount.

Flaggor ärvda från BlobFuse2-kommandot

Följande flaggor ärvs från kommandot blobfuse2grandparent :

Flagga Kort version Värdetyp Standardvärde Beskrivning
disable-version-check boolean falskt Aktiverar eller inaktiverar automatisk versionskontroll av BlobFuse2-binärfiler
hjälp -h saknas Hjälpinformation för blobfuse2-kommandot och underkommandon

Flaggor som ärvts från blobfuse2-monteringskommandot

Följande flaggor ärvs från det överordnade kommandot blobfuse2 mount:

Flagga Värdetyp Standardvärde Beskrivning
allow-other boolean falskt Tillåt andra användare att komma åt den här monteringspunkten
attr-cache-timeout uint32 120 Tidsgräns för attributcache
(i sekunder)
attr-timeout uint32 Tidsgräns för attribut
(i sekunder)
config-file sträng ./config.yaml Sökvägen för filen där kontoautentiseringsuppgifterna anges Som standard är config.yaml i den aktuella katalogen.
containernamn sträng Namnet på containern som ska monteras
entry-timeout uint32 Tidsgräns för inmatning
(i sekunder)
file-cache-timeout uint32 120 Tidsgräns för filcache
(i sekunder)
förgrund boolean falskt Om filsystemet är monterat i förgrundsläge
log-file-path sträng $HOME/.blobfuse2/blobfuse2.log Sökvägen för loggfiler
loggnivå LOG_OFF
LOG_CRIT
LOG_ERR
LOG_WARNING
LOG_INFO
LOG_DEBUG
LOG_WARNING
LOG_WARNING Loggningsnivån som skrivits till --log-file-path.
negativ timeout uint32 Tidsgränsen för negativ post
(i sekunder)
no-symlinks boolean falskt Huruvida symlinks ska stödjas eller inte
lösenfras sträng Nyckel för att dekryptera konfigurationsfilen.
Kan också anges av env-variable BLOBFUSE2_SECURE_CONFIG_PASSPHRASE
Nyckellängden ska vara 16 (AES-128), 24 (AES-192) eller 32 (AES-256) byte i längd.
skrivskyddad boolean falskt Montera systemet i skrivskyddat läge
secure-config boolean falskt Kryptera automatiskt genererad konfigurationsfil för varje container
tmp-path sträng saknas Konfigurerar tmp-platsen för cacheminnet.
(Konfigurera den snabbaste disken (SSD eller ramdisk) för bästa prestanda).

Exempel

Anteckning

Följande exempel förutsätter att du redan har skapat en konfigurationsfil i den aktuella katalogen.

Montera alla bloblagringscontainrar i lagringskontot som anges i konfigurationsfilen till den sökväg som anges i kommandot . (Varje container är en underkatalog under den angivna katalogen):

sudo mkdir bf2all
sudo blobfuse2 mount all ./bf2all --config-file=./config.yaml

Exempel på utdata

Mounting container : blobfuse2a to path : bf2all/blobfuse2a
Mounting container : blobfuse2b to path : bf2all/blobfuse2b
sudo blobfuse2 mount list

Exempel på utdata

1 : /home/<user>/bf2all/blobfuse2a
2 : /home/<user>/bf2all/blobfuse2b

Se även